Finance Review Summary — Supplier Contract Renewal

Prepared for the board of Marivelle Textiles. The renewal with Brackenford Mills has been negotiated at a 3% unit-price increase, below the sector trend, with volume rebates preserved and payment terms extended to sixty days. Quality clauses are unchanged; a penalty schedule now covers late deliveries. Finance recommends approval at the next sitting. The confidential note on business plans appears directly below.

board note of bajop-yaweg: The western region missed its Pelys quota by 58.0 percent last quarter. Pelysek Foods plans to raise the Belius list price by 44.0 percent in July. The steering committee signed off on a budget of $133.8 million for Project Pelax. The renewal with Zoraelix Systems closes at $61.9 million a year, 12.7 percent above the last contract.

## Further Reading

Before cutting a release that touches the Vigilseat proctoring queue, review the capacity model and the session-replay retention rules, since both constrain rollout timing during exam season. Deploy freezes are coordinated with the Oakbridge assessments team. The authoritative scheduling calendar and freeze policy are maintained on the internal page below.

wiki page, hahif-hahif: https://argocd.kelvisys.corp/browse/board/settings/pages/1442e0b1065d83f1

## Runbook: Nightfill Scheduler Restart

If the Nightfill scheduler at Corvax Analytics misses its 02:00 window, the backfill queue for the Pelling warehouse tables will stall. Verify the coordinator pod is healthy, then requeue any partitions marked stale in the Harker console. Do not trigger a manual backfill while the queue drains; duplicate writes will corrupt the rollup tables. Once the queue reaches zero, confirm the scheduler picked up the current release. The deployed build is recorded directly below this line.

session token of hawif-bajog = htk6_9ab8da

Escalation: search relevance tuning (Querna stack). If customers report stale or nonsensical rankings, first check the synonym pack version in the Tunefeed dashboard. Do not restart the ranker yourself — tuning experiments may be mid-flight. Capture three example queries with expected vs. actual results. Then escalate to the Relevance Guild using the address below.

alerts address for hawif-yagug: istox@orvexsoft.local